Ryan Left The science Museum and drove south Gabriella left three hours later driving 42 km/h faster in an effort to catch up to him . after two hours Gabriella finally caught up find ryans average speed
Ryan time = t
Gabriella time = t-3 = 2 hours so t = 5
Ryan speed = s
Gabriella speed = s+42
same distance
distance = speed * time
s t = (s+42)(t-3)
s(5) = (s+42)(2)
3 s = 84
s = 84/3 = 28 km/hr
